Firmware design of a portable medical device to measure the quadriceps muscle group after a total knee arthroplasty by EMG, LBIA and clinical score methods

Abstract

El objetivo de este proyecto es el diseño del firmware de un dispositivo médico portátil para mediciones de EMG y LBIA, que se utilizará para la evaluación de pacientes de artroplastia total de rodilla, para estudiar la progresión de diferentes prótesis de rodilla (Medial-Pivot y Ultra-Congruente). En la tesis, se expone el conocimiento actual de los estudios y aplicaciones de EMG y LBIA, junto con los dispositivos comerciales utilizados actualmente. Además, se han estudiado e implementado las diferentes técnicas de filtrado y procesamiento digital para señales de EMG y LBIAs. Adicionalmente, se ha realizado un estudio estadístico preliminar con datos LBIA de 12 pacientes de artroplastia total de rodilla. El diseño del firmware de esta tesis incluye: los procesos de adquisición de datos con el uso de diferentes ADCs (Conversor Analógico a Digital) (de la propia placa y externos, utilizando la interfaz SPI) y un DAC (Conversor Digital a Analógico), el correspondiente procesamiento de la señal y la extracción de sus características, la comunicación con un dispositivo externo utilizando un módulo BLE externo con interfaz UART, el proceso de encriptación de los datos médicos, la funcionalidad de manejo de errores y la aproximación del nivel de batería. En esta tesis, todos los flujos de trabajo de los procesos se exponen y explican mediante diagramas de flujo, mientras que se justifica cada cálculo y configuración. Además, todo el código correspondiente se ha programado en lenguaje C y se expone en los anexos. También se ha revisado la normativa aplicable y se ha analizado tanto el impacto ambiental como el coste económico del producto. Por último, se proponen mejoras para futuros trabajos.The aim of this project is the firmware design for a portable medical device for EMG and LBIA measurements which will be used for the assessment of total knee arthroplasty patients to study the progression of different knee prostheses (Medial-Pivot and Ultra-Congruent). For its realization, the state of the art of the EMG and LBIA studies and applications are exposed, along with the currently used medical devices. In addition, the different digital filtering and processing techniques for these studies have been studied and implemented. Furthermore, a preliminary statistical study has been performed with LBIA data from 12 patients with total knee arthroplasty. The firmware design of this thesis includes: the acquiring data processes with the use of different ADCs (from the actual board and external, using the SPI interface) and a DAC, the corresponding signal processing and feature abstraction, the communication with an external device using an external BLE module with UART interface, the medical data encrypting process, the error handling functionality, and the battery level approximation. In this work, all the process workflows are exposed and explained using flowcharts, while every calculation and configuration is justified. In addition, all the corresponding code has been programmed using C language and exposed in the Annexes. Moreover, the applicable regulation has been reviewed, and both the environmental impact and economic cost of the product have been analyzed. Finally, improvements are proposed for future work.L'objectiu d'aquest projecte és el disseny del microprogramari d'un dispositiu mèdic portàtil per a mesures d'EMG i LBIA. L’aparell mèdic s'utilitzarà per a l'avaluació de pacients d'artroplàstia total de genoll per estudiar la progressió de dues pròtesis de genoll (Medial-Pivot i Ultra- Congruent). En el treball, s'exposa el coneixement actual dels estudis i aplicacions d'EMG i LBIA, juntament amb els dispositius comercials utilitzats actualment. A més, s'han estudiat i implementat les diferents tècniques de filtrat i processament digital dels senyals de EMG i LBIA. Addicionalment, s'ha fet un estudi estadístic preliminar amb dades de LBIA de 12 pacients amb artroplàstia total de genoll. El disseny del microprogramari d'aquesta tesi inclou: els processos d'adquisició de dades fent ús de diferents ADCs (de la pròpia placa i externs, utilitzant la interfície SPI) i un DAC, el processament dels senyals i l'abstracció de les seves característiques, la comunicació amb un dispositiu extern utilitzant un mòdul BLE extern amb interfície UART, el procés d'encriptació de les dades mèdiques, la funcionalitat de l’avaluació d'errors i l'aproximació del nivell de bateria. En aquest treball, totes les funcionalitats del dispositiu s'exposen i s'expliquen mitjançant diagrames de flux i es justifiquen els càlculs i configuracions corresponents. Tot el codi desenvolupat s'ha programat en llenguatge C i s'exposa als annexos. A més, s'ha revisat la normativa aplicable i s'ha analitzat tant l'impacte ambiental com el cost econòmic de l’aparell. Finalment, es proposen millores per a futurs desenvolupaments

    Similar works